余额“消失”不是魔法:TP钱包、同质化代币与跨链支付的故障定位新范式

TP钱包里“余额消失”的瞬间,像一次被动的网络体检:你以为资产不见了,实则可能是显示层、链选择、代币标准或交易回执的多重错位。要拆开这类问题,先把“资产”分成两部分:链上真实状态与钱包界面的映射结果。链上真实状态不可逆变(除非你确实发生了转账/兑换/合约交互),而钱包展示则可能被链路、代币标准、账户推导或界面缓存影响。以Satoshi白皮书所确立的比特币共识思想为底座——“没有有效的签名就无法花费”——我们可以把排查逻辑锚定在签名与交易上,而不是只盯着余额数字。

**区块链支付:先确认你在“看哪条链”**

TP钱包的资产通常依赖“当前网络/链”选择。若切换到错误链(例如看到了ETH相关,但钱包却当前处于另一条兼容EVM链),同名地址下可能根本没有同等资产,从而出现“余额消失”。同样,跨链支付常用桥与路由合约,最终到账往往发生在另一条链上;若钱包未同步/未添加目标网络,你会看到“少了一截”。这类现象与区块链支付的基本机制一致:转账结果取决于接收链、交易回执与索引服务。

**同质化代币:别忽略Token合约与标准差异**

同质化代币(ERC-20等)并不等价于“余额”。钱包展示的往往是合约地址+账户地址对应的balanceOf结果。你可能遇到:

1)代币合约地址变化或被替换(换合约/更换版本);

2)代币被“伪装/同名”——同符号不同合约;

3)代币授权/路由导致实际发生兑换或合约扣款(余额会在链上真实变化)。

可用权威思路参考以太坊开发文档对合约交互的规范(尤其是ERC-20的balanceOf与decimals定义),并在区块浏览器中用合约地址+持币地址核对,而不是只看钱包列表。

**钱包多标签页支持:视图隔离造成的“错觉”**

“多标签页支持”在现代钱包中普遍存在:不同标签页可能绑定不同网络、不同筛选条件或不同会话状态。你在A标签页看到的资产来自某种缓存与网络上下文,而在B标签页打开时使用另一套上下文,数字就可能不同。建议先统一:

- 同一标签页内核对链选择

- 手动刷新/重新同步

- 关闭可能影响显示的自定义筛选(隐藏零余额、仅显示NFT等)

- 若可切换视图(资产/收藏/交易记录),优先回到链上查询。

**比特币:UTXO世界的“余额口径”不同**

比特币不像EVM代币那样直接balanceOf,它的余额来自UTXO集合的聚合。若你在钱包里只看到部分分配或显示延迟,可能是地址类型(legacy/segwit/taproot)与衍生路径不同,导致你“没看见”那批UTXO。注意:比特币的权威依据来自共识与UTXO验证规则;钱包只是在用不同地址集去扫描。若扫描策略或同步状态异常,就会出现“看起来没了”的现象。

**前沿科技创新:用多功能接口做“证据链”而非盲信**

当你怀疑余额消失,最有效的是把证据链拉通:交易查询接口(Tx)→ 地址余额接口(Balance)→ 代币合约查询(Token balanceOf)→ 同步状态(Index/Cache)。多功能接口的价值在于“把显示问题定位为数据源问题”。例如:同一地址在浏览器上余额存在,而钱包界面不显示,通常是索引服务/本地缓存/合约列表配置导致;反之若浏览器也不存在,则说明链上资产确实转出或发生合约结算。

**快速定位清单(按优先级)**

1)确认当前网络/链:是否切到目标链?

2)核对持币地址:钱包导出/查看地址是否与区块浏览器一致。

3)对同质化代币:检查是否为正确合约地址、是否添加了代币、symbol是否同名但合约不同。

4)对NFT或代币混合视图:是否被筛选隐藏。

5)对比特币:确认地址类型与派生路径是否与钱包扫描一致。

6)检查交易记录与授权:是否有Swap/bridge/合约调用导致余额变化。

权威参考可从以太坊ERC-20标准对接口语义(balanceOf/decimals)与比特币UTXO共识验证思路入手,同时以区块浏览器与链上交易回执作为“可验证事实”。余额不是凭感觉消失,而是在可追溯的链上数据里改变。

——

**互动投票:你更像遇到哪一种“消失”?(选/投票)**

1)切换网络后余额立刻恢复(网络选择问题)

2)链上浏览器能看到,但钱包列表不显示(索引/展示问题)

3)同名代币symbol对不上真实合约(合约识别问题)

4)比特币地址类型不同导致UTXO未被扫描(BTC口径问题)

5)钱包显示少了,但浏览器也确实没了(链上真实变动)

作者:夜航链编辑部发布时间:2026-05-27 06:18:10

评论

Luna链影

我遇到过“链切错”导致余额瞬间归零,刷新+核对网络后就恢复了,证据查浏览器最稳。

阿尔法Mint

同名ERC20很坑,钱包显示有符号但合约地址不同,最后用合约地址balanceOf验证才彻底排除。

ChainFox

多标签页真的会误导我:A页是主网,B页不小心切了另一条,资产列表完全不同。

PixelWarden

如果涉及桥接/跨链支付,到账链没加就会像“消失”,你这篇把链路思路写得很清楚。

星河探员

比特币部分很对劲:地址类型不同会导致UTXO扫描不全,钱包显示差异不等于资产丢失。

相关阅读